5.6cr Indians lived outside their state of birth in 2011

According to Census 2011 migration data, more than 5.6 crore Indians lived in states other than the ones they were born in. UP, Bihar, Rajasthan and MP had the highest ‘outmigration’. Maharashtra, Delhi and Gujarat had the largest ‘in-migration’. Karnataka crisis: What’s a ‘whip’, and what does it do?

A whip in parliamentary parlance is a written order that party members be present for an important vote, or that they vote only in a particular way. In India all parties can issue a whip to their members.
